2003 Chinon Cabernet Franc
Les Quatre Terroirs Cabernet Franc from the revered Chinon region in 2003 is a delightful expression of this varietal, showcasing a medium body that is perfectly balanced. Its acidity offers a bright and refreshing touch, enhancing the wine's overall liveliness. The fruit intensity is prominent, revealing enticing notes of red berries, such as raspberry and cranberry, intertwined with subtle hints of herbs and pepper. The tannins are firm yet approachable, providing structure without overpowering the wine's elegance. This Cabernet Franc is crafted in a dry style, making it incredibly versatile and food-friendly, ideal for pairing with a variety of dishes or enjoying on its own. The complexity and depth of flavors make this wine a true testament to the unique terroirs of Chinon.
